Hwa-Tung Nieh

Professor, Director (1997-2012)

Education background

B.Sc. National Taiwan University, Taipei, Taiwan, China

M.A. Case Western Reserve University, Cleveland, Ohio, U.S.A.

Ph.D. Harvard University, Cambridge, Massachusetts, U.S.A.

Experience

Director and Professor 1997-present Institute for Advanced Study, Tsinghua University

Professor Emeritus 1997-present C.N. Yang Institute for Theoretical Physics, State University of New York at Stony Brook

Assistant Professor, Associate Professor, Professor 1968-1997 State University of New York at Stony Brook

Research Associate 1966-1968 Institute for Theoretical Physics, State University of New York at Stony Brook

Adjunct Professor 1998-present Hong Kong University of Science & Technology

Visting Professor 1998-present Peking University

Visting Professor 1999-present China University of Science & Technology

Areas of Research Interests/ Research Projects

Quantum Gravity Theory

Topological Properties of Quantum Gravity

Propagation of Neutrinos in Super-dense Media
